Generation X

Generation X

Year: 1996

Runtime: 87 mins

Language: English

Director: Jack Sholder

TV MovieScience FictionFantasyAction

Welcome to the future where a cadre of young mutants—humans with a genetic variation granting super‑powers and provoking widespread fear—enroll in a hero training academy. Their coursework is cut short when they must infiltrate a mad scientist’s scheme to rescue a teammate, confronting his ability to invade others’ dreams.
